A Nurse is caring for a client who has cancer and is terminally ill. The

nurse should recognize that the client and their family might be

experiencing which of the following types of grief?

a) disenfrachised

b) Complicated

c) Anticipatory


d) Traumatic - ANSWER ✔✔C) Anticipatory

,A charge nurse is observing a newly hired nurse provide grief informed

care for a client. Which of the following actions by the newly hired nurse

requires a follow up by the charge nurse?

A) the nurse asks the client why they require care

B) the nurse advocates for the client to receive bereavement support

C) the nurse acknowledges that the client experienced a death or loss

D) the nurse determines the effect the death or loss has had on the

client - ANSWER ✔✔A) the nurse asks the client why they require

care

A nurse is caring for a client and notes that the client appears

disheveled, frightened and seems to be talking to someone who is not

there. The nurse should identify that this is an example of which of the

following steps of the nursing process?

A) Planning

B) Analysis

C) Assessment


D) Evaluation - ANSWER ✔✔C) Assessment


A nurse manager and a newly licensed nurse are engaged in an

interview with a client. The newly licensed nurse tells the client. "You

,look like my sister. I love my sister and would do anything for her." Which

of the following actions should the nurse manager take?

A) Ask the newly licensed nurse if they are comfortable providing care to

the client

B) Inform the newly licensed nurse that they are successfully building

trust and rapport

C) Record that the newly licensed nurse is able to maintain professional

nurse client boundaries


D) Assign nurse to a different client - ANSWER ✔✔D) Assign nurse to

a different client

A nurse is providing care for a client who has recently returned from

active combat and experienced the loss of a close friend during combat.

Which of the following client statements indicates that the client is

experiencing traumatic grief?

A) It has been more than a year and I still do not want to leave the

house.

B) When I have flashbacks, it feels like my heart is going to beat through

my chest

, C) I should have been killed instead of my friend - ANSWER ✔✔B)

When I have flashbacks, it feels like my heart is going to beat through

my chest

A nurse is caring for a client who experienced abuse. The client says, "It

was my fault I made my partner upset" The nurse should identify that the

client is demonstrating which of the following manifestations?

A) Guilt

B) anger

C) dependency


D) fear - ANSWER ✔✔A) Guilt
